As anyone who runs a blog will know, the amount of spam comments can be extremely depressing. Luckily for me over the last week the spammers appear to have changed tactic from the usual “Great post! Lots of useful information here” type of comment to something altogether more sinister, and I enjoy variety.
When Spammers Attack
A good example of this is a spam comment received on a text-only post, demanding that I stop relying on “the video” to make my point for me and wasting my intelligence. Lovely, I must say. The number one spot so far however goes to the following comment, received just yesterday:
I dont know who you think you are, but youre just blowing smoke out your ears. Nothing youre saying makes sense and its all a bunch of immature ranting. If you want people to get behind your blog, you should at the very least learn a little something about what youre talking about!
Now I know what you’re thinking, how do I know it’s spam? The clue was in the commenter name, and in the fact that the exact same drivel shows up on a load more blogs in a Google search. My blog isn’t immature ranting…it’s just pointless.
